how many grams of cacl2 can be produced from 50.0 grams of hcl

Answers

Answer:

76.0 g

Explanation:

Step 1: Write the balanced equation

2 HCl + Ca(OH)₂ ⇒ CaCl₂ + 2 H₂O

Step 2: Calculate the moles corresponding to 50.0 g of HCl

The molar mass of HCl is 36.46 g/mol.

50.0 g × 1 mol/36.46 g = 1.37 mol

Step 3: Calculate the number of moles of CaCl₂ produced from 1.37 moles of HCl

The molar ratio of HCl to CaCl₂ is 2:1. The moles of CaCl₂ produced are 1/2 × 1.37 mol = 0.685 mol.

Step 4: Calculate the mass corresponding to 0.685 moles of CaCl₂

The molar mass of CaCl₂ is 110.98 g/mol.

0.685 mol × 110.98 g/mol = 76.0 g

A 30.141 mg sample of a chemical known to contain only carbon, hydrogen, sulfur, and oxygen is put into a combustion analysis apparatus, yielding 53.694 mg of carbon dioxide and 21.980 mg of water. In another experiment, 30.199 mg of the compound is reacted with excess oxygen to produce 13.05 mg of sulfur dioxide. Add subscripts to the formula provided to correctly identify the empirical formula of this compound. Do not change the order of the elements empirical formula: CHSO

Answers

Answer:

The empirical formula of the chemical compound is C₆H₁₂SO₂

Explanation:

To determine the empirical formula, the mass of each element in the compound is first determined from their respective compounds formed after combustion analysis.

Mass of element = mass of compound × molar mass of element / molar mass of compound

Carbon: 53.694 g x (12g/mol / 44.0 g/mol) = 14.643 mg of C in 30.141 mg sample Hydrogen: 21.980 mg x ( 2.00 / 18.00) = 2.442 mg of H in 30.141 mg sample

Sulfur: 13.05 mg x (32.00/ 64.00) = 6.525 mg of S in 30.199 mg in sample

The percentage mass composition of the elements in the compound is then determined:

Carbon: 14.643 mg / 30.141 mg = 48.58%

Hydrogen: 2.442 mg / 30.141 mg = 8.10%

Sulfur: 6.525 mg / 30.199 mg = 21.60 %

Oxygen: 100% - (48.58% + 8.10% +21.60%) = 21.72%

Number of moles of each element is then determined:

Number of moles = percentage mass/molar mass

Carbon: 48.58/12 = 4.07

Hydrogen: 8.10/1 = 8.10

Sulfur: 21.60/32 = 0.68

Oxygen: 21.72/16 = 1.36

Dividing with the smallest amount to obtain a whole number mole ratio

Carbon: 4.07 ÷ 0.68 = 6

Hydrogen: 8.10 ÷ 0.68 = 12

Sulfur: 0.68 ÷ 0.68 = 1

Oxygen: 1.36 ÷ 0.68 = 2

Therefore, the empirical formula of the chemical compound is C₆H₁₂SO₂

A gas at STP occupies 0.055 L of space. If the pressure changes to
2.8 atm and the temperature increases to 195°C, what is the new
volume?

Answers

Answer:

0.034 L

Explanation:

From the question given above, the following data were obtained:

Initial volume (V₁) = 0.055 L

Initial pressure (P₁) = stp = 1 atm

Initial temperature (T₁) = stp = 273 K

Final pressure (P₂) = 2.8 atm

Final temperature (T₂) = 195 °C = 195 °C + 273 = 468 K

Final volume (V₂) =?

The final volume of the gas can be obtained as follow:

P₁V₁ / T₁ = P₂V₂ / T₂

1 × 0.055 / 273 = 2.8 × V₂ / 468

0.055 / 273 = 2.8 × V₂ / 468

Cross multiply

273 × 2.8 × V₂ = 0.055 × 468

764.4 × V₂ = 25.74

Divide both side by 764.4

V₂ = 25.74 / 764.4

V₂ = 0.034 L

Therefore, the new volume of the gas is 0.034 L.

Observe: Click Reset (). The electrons in the outermost orbit, called valence electrons, help to create chemical bonds. Create a lithium atom (3 protons, 4 neutrons, 3 electrons). How many valence electrons are in a neutral lithium atom?

Answers

Answer:

There is one valence electron in a neutral lithium atom.

Explanation:

The number of valence electrons in a neutral lithium atom is equal to one.

What is a valence electron?

Valence electrons can be described as the electrons filling the outermost shell of an atom while the electrons in the inner shell of an atom are known as core electrons. Lewis structures are used to determine the number of valence electrons and know the types of chemical bonds.

Valence electrons of an atom can be filled in the same or different orbitals and these electrons are responsible for the interaction between atoms and cause the formation of chemical bonds.

Only electrons occupied in the outermost shell can participate in the formation of a bond or a molecule and are responsible for the reactivity of the element.

The number of electrons in the neutral atom of lithium is 3. There is only one electron present on the outermost shell 2s-orbital.

Identify the true statement(s). There may be one answer or more than one answer.FADH2 is a reducing agent. FADH2 is an oxidizing agent. NADH is an oxidizing agent. NADPH is a reducing agent. FAD is an oxidizing agent.

Answers

Answer:

FADH2 is a reducing agent.

FAD is an oxidizing agent.

Explanation:

The full form of FAD is flavin adenine dinucleotide. It is mainly a redox-active coenzyme which is associated with the different proteins and is involved with the enzymatic reactions in the metabolism.

FAD is obtained by donating or accepting electrons.

In the citric acid cycle,

succinate + FAD → fumarate + [tex]$FADH_2$[/tex]

Thus we see that FAD is an oxidizing agent while [tex]$FADH_2$[/tex] is a reducing agent.
